| Nancy1999 | 06-18-2008 12:39 PM | I recommend that someone thoroughly check out a breeder before buying a puppy. Reading the nursery threads shouldn't be considered "too much trouble," and a person should always check out the sire and dam of the pup, and the kennel conditions. However, a breeder in my opinion, should be much more diligent, in finding a puppy, and care should really be taken when choosing your breeding stock. I may be wrong, but it kind of sounds like you want someone to come to you and offer to sell you their dog, and I think this would be the absolute worst way to select a dog. Anyone, who would do this is a very poor breeder indeed. They would want to get to know you and your breeding program, and you would want to do the same with them. Some people on the forum have taken several years to find suitable pets that aren't use for breeding. I recommend you take plenty of time to find a potential breeding pup. |
